Product Description
This Kit is based on photographs of the small Mackenzie-Holland signal cabin that once existes at Chirk station.
This print contains Blank Nameboard, Balcony and Stairs, Roof Vent, Frame Room Door and Window which should be printed in "Fine Detail Plastic. The suggested painting scheme is Door, Roof Vent, Stairs and Balcony GWR Dark Stone, window white, (see illustration of completed model). Nameboards were usually white letters on a black background. Door panels can also be picked out in GWR Light Stone.
